inspired by the geico insurance commercials, cavemen takes a look at life
through the eyes of three modern cavemen as they journey through the world.
joel, nick and jamie are contemporary cavemen living in suburbia trying to be
ordinary men leading ordinary lives. as they try to assimilate into modern
world, nick begins to feel like society will never fully accept them, jamie goes
with the flow, and joel finds himself torn between tradition and modern life.
